Edgestream Partners L.P. Boosts Stock Position in nCino Inc. (NASDAQ:NCNO)

nCino logo with Computer and Technology background

Edgestream Partners L.P. grew its position in shares of nCino Inc. (NASDAQ:NCNO - Free Report) by 149.7% in the first qu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 292,026 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 175,092 shares during the quarter. Edgestream Partners L.P. owned about 0.25% of nCino worth $8,022,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Insider Activity

In other nCino news, CEO Sean Desmond sold 12,339 shares of nCino stock in a transaction dated Friday, May 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$23.00, for a total value of $283,797.00. Following the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 637,405 shares in the company, valued at $14,660,315. The trade was a 1.90%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. Also, VP Jeanette Sellers sold 2,167 shares of nCino stock in a transaction dated Monday, May 5th. The shares were sold at an average price of $22.79, for a total value of $49,385.93. Following the completion of the transaction, the vice president owned 27,108 shares in the company, valued at $617,791.32. This trade represents a 7.40%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. In the last 90 days, insiders have sold 63,049 shares of company stock valued at $1,449,672. Company insiders own 5.70% of the company's stock.

nCino (NASDAQ:NCNO -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 28th. The company reported $0.16 EPS for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.16. The firm had revenue of $144.14 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$139.77 million. nCino had a positive return on equity of 0.19% and a negative net margin of 5.27%.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 12.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$0.19 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ts predict that nCino Inc. will post 0.12 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

nCino declared that its board has initiated a stock repurchase plan on Tuesday, April 1st that authorizes the company to repurchase $100.00 million in outstanding shares. This repurchase authorization authorizes the company to buy up to 3.1% of its stock through open market purchases. Stock repurchase plans are typically a sign that the company's board of directors believes its shares are undervalued.

About nCino

(Free Report)

nCino, Inc, a software-as-a-service company, provides cloud-based software applications to financial institutions in the United States and internationally. Its nCino Bank Operating System connects financial institution employees, clients and third parties on a single cloud-based platform which include client onboarding, deposit account opening, loan origination, end-to-end mortgage suite, and powerful ecosystem.
